Technical Analysis

Key technical levels for NEXN are well-defined from recent trading activity, with immediate support identified at $6.37 and immediate resistance at $7.05. The $6.37 support level has acted as a reliable floor over the past several weeks, with the stock bouncing off this mark each time it has been tested, typically on below-average selling volume that suggests limited downside conviction among sellers at that price point. On the upside, the $7.05 resistance level has capped all recent attempts at upward moves, with selling pressure picking up consistently as NEXN approaches this threshold, leading to retracements back toward the middle of its current trading range.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ating that it is neither overbought nor oversold at current levels, leaving room for potential moves in either direction without hitting extreme technical sentiment thresholds. NEXN is currently trading just above its short-term moving average, while its medium-term moving average sits just below the $6.37 support level, potentially acting as a secondary support layer if the immediate support mark is breached in upcoming sessions. Outlook

Near-term price action for NEXN will likely hinge on tests of the identified support and resistance levels, with two primary scenarios being monitored by traders. A sustained break above the $7.05 resistance level on high volume could potentially signal a shift in short-term sentiment, possibly opening the door to a move outside of the recent trading range as sellers who had been active at that level are cleared out. On the downside, a decisive break below the $6.37 support level could indicate rising selling conviction, potentially leading to further near-term downside pressure as short-term traders who entered positions at the lower end of the range exit their holdings. Broader macroeconomic news flow, particularly updates related to interest rate policy and enterprise spending intentions, could also influence NEXN’s price action in the coming weeks by driving flows into or out of the broader tech services sector. In the absence of confirmed upcoming company-specific catalysts, technical levels are expected to remain a key focus for market participants tracking the stock in the near term.
